The Sun Hydraulics PPJFCNN (Material Number: PPJFCNN) is a pilot-operated, pressure reducing-relieving valve designed to reduce high primary pressure at the inlet port 2 to a consistent reduced pressure at port 1, while also providing a full-flow relief function from port 1 to tank port 3. The valve's main stage orifice is drilled into the piston, enhancing its durability for physically demanding applications. Maximum pressure at port 3 should be limited to 3000 psi (210 bar), and it is directly additive to the valve setting at a 1:1 ratio. The recommended maximum inlet pressure varies by adjustment range, with ranges D, E, N, and Q tested up to a 2000 psi (140 bar) differential, ranges A, B, and H up to a 3000 psi (210 bar) differential, and ranges C and W up to a maximum of 5000 psi (350 bar). These valves are known for their exceptionally flat pressure-flow characteristics, stability, and low hysteresis. However, they are not fast-acting; for superior dynamic response, direct-acting valves are recommended. The PPJFCNN model incorporates Sun's floating style construction to minimize binding due to excessive torque or machining variations. It has a cavity size of T-19A Series 4 with an impressive capacity of up to 80 gpm (320 L/min). The factory pressure settings are established with blocked control ports. The valve requires an installation torque between 350 - 375 lbf-ft (474 - 508 Nm) and features an adjustment screw internal hex size of 5/32 inch (4 mm). For applications requiring reverse flow from reduced pressure port 1 back to inlet port 2 without closing the main spool, an additional check valve may be necessary in the circuit.

Pilot-operated, pressure reducing/relieving valves reduce a high primary pressure at the inlet (port 2) to a constant reduced pressure at port 1, with a full-flow relief function from port 1 to tank (port 3).
- These valves have the main stage orifice drilled into the piston rather than a staked-in orifice. This allows the valve to survive physically demanding applications.
- Maximum pressure at port 3 should be limited to 3000 psi (210 bar).
- Pressure at port 3 is directly additive to the valve setting at a 1:1 ratio and should not exceed 3000 psi (210 bar).
- Pilot operated reducing, reducing/relieving valves by nature are not fast acting valves. For superior dynamic response, consider direct acting valves.
- Recommended maximum inlet pressure is determined by the adjustment range. Ranges D, E, N, and Q are tested with a 2000 psi (140 bar) maximum differential between inlet and reduced pressure. Ranges A, B, and H are tested with a 3000 psi (210 bar) maximum differential between inlet and reduced pressure. Ranges C and W are tested with 5000 psi (350 bar) of inlet pressure.
- Pilot operated valves exhibit exceptionally flat pressure/flow characteristics, are very stable and have low hysteresis.
- Full reverse flow from reduced pressure (port 1) to inlet (port 2) may cause the main spool to close. If reverse free flow is required in the circuit, consider adding a separate check valve to the circuit.
- If pilot flow consumption is critical, consider using direct acting reducing/relieving valves.
- All three-port pressure reducing and reducing/relieving cartridges are physically interchangeable (i.e. same flow path, same cavity for a given frame size). When considering mounting configurations, it is sometimes recommended that a full capacity return line (port 3) be used with reducing/relieving cartridges.
- Incorporates the Sun floating style construction to minimize the possibility of internal parts binding due to excessive installation torque and/or cavity/cartridge machining variations.
| Cavity | T-19A |
| Series | 4 |
| Capacity | 80 gpm320 L/min. |
| Factory Pressure Settings Established at | blocked control port (dead headed)blocked control port (dead headed) |
| Maximum Operating Pressure | 5000 psi350 bar |
| Control Pilot Flow | 15 - 20 in³/min.0,25 - 0,33 L/min. |
| Adjustment - Number of Clockwise Turns to Increase Setting | 55 |
| Valve Hex Size | 1 5/8 in.41,3 mm |
| Valve Installation Torque | 350 - 375 lbf ft474 - 508 Nm |
| Adjustment Screw Internal Hex Size | 5/32 in.4 mm |
| Locknut Hex Size | 9/16 in.15 mm |
| Locknut Torque | 80 - 90 lbf in.9 - 10 Nm |
| Model Weight | 3.10 lb1,40 kg |
| Seal kit - Cartridge | Viton: 990-019-006 |
